Glasdrumman GAC Notes

The U-10’s kept up their good run of late with a great win, this time against a much improved Ballymartin side writes Tony Bannon.xa0

In their last meeting it was an easy win for Glasdrumman and although they had a few points to spare in this one, Ballymartin made the home team work hard to earn victory. Peter Doran started in goals while the back line was made up of the ever improving Jack McVeigh, Eoin McVeigh and the excellent Cáolam Smith who gave a master class in defending. Darragh Rooney moved from his usual Full Back role to partner “the Gooch” Martin Stevenson. The strong forward line consisted of Aine Trimble, Sean Kelly and Cormac McComb. So another good performance from this young team who have Attical up next at St Mary’s Park Glasdrumman next Monday.dn_screen

The B match saw Conaire McDowell return from injury to take up his customary place in goals and it also gave the management another look to see what players could be called upon for first team action. The B team were: Conaire McDowell, Nathan Brennan, Niall and Ryan McCartan, Peter Doran, Sé Rooney, Aoife McComb, Tara Grant, Ollie and George Thompson.

The U-14’s have had a few tough games away against Clann na Derg and at home to Saval. Although the boys have been beaten, some fantastic displays of football have been played. They played Clann na Derg at homexa0on Mondayxa0night, have still to play the Longstone at home and Burrn B away, Good Luck boys and lets get a win in the bag!!
